At NxtWave, product developers with a deep passion for teaching offer the training. By combining knowledge with practical experience, our trainers simplify complex concepts and deliver them clearly and concisely.
We have an exciting opportunity for you at NxtWave. Create a lasting impact on students from tier-2,3,4 colleges who speak your mother tongue and enable them to become great developers by breaking their language barrier to learn to code.
Work Location: NxtWave Office spaces in Hyderabad
Working days: 6 days a week
Type of employment: Full-Time
Probation Period: 2 Months
Bachelors or Masters degree from a recognised university in computer science related stream
Need to have previous teaching or training experience in the field of computer science
Alignment to the company's vision and culture
Professional fluency in English
Excellent presentation & communication skills. Should be able to explain complex subjects clearly and interestingly
Expertise in content development using tools like Google Sheets, Google Slides, etc..( Knowledge of Microsoft 365 stack is an added advantage )
Any teaching or mentorship experience will be an added advantage
Ability to handle a class of 100 to 150 students
Strong proficiency in Python, and JavaScript Programming skills
Strong knowledge of the subject matter, industry standards, and best practices
Strong knowledge of Python and Java Script Programming languages
Hands-on experience in software development for 1 year in MERN stack
Good knowledge of Object-oriented programming
Familiarity with Git
Ability to adapt training methods to various learning styles
Should have a problem-solving and solution-seeking mindset
Be open to receiving objective criticism and improving upon it
Openness for iterations and feedback
Driven by ownership, hustle, and delivery
.
Deliver daily in person classroom training on programming and full stack development
Contribute to curriculum development and final deliverables
Handle class of 100-150 students
Review deliverables for accuracy and quality